At least 4 dead and 8 injured in shell attack on governor’s residence in Kunduz Province Afghanistan

November 2 According to Afghan Dawn TV, the Afghan security department said that on the evening of November 1, local time, the residence of the governor of Kunduz Province in Afghanistan was hit by a mortar shell, killing at least four people. Eight people were injured.

Kunduz Governor’s spokesperson Esmatullah Muladi said that mortar shells hit the sports field inside the building and some soldiers were playing volleyball. He said there were casualties, but did not provide further details.

However, according to sources, the victims were all security guards of the Governor of Kunduz. Among the injured, 2 were government employees and 6 were members of the security forces.

According to reports, the Kunduz Governor’s spokesperson accused the Taliban of Afghanistan of launching the attack, but the Taliban has not yet responded to this.
